> I have a php site where people can upload pictures. I would like to
> automatically resize the picture to create a thumbnail but I would
> also like to reduce the image quality. Do you know of any unix/linux
> programs out there that can be programmed to do this.
>
> Thanks
Imagemagick Comes to mind for generaing thumbnails. Not sure about image
resolution part but maybe you can achieve that by converting to a more lossy
format ?
